About This Book
The soft splash of river water and the gentle rumble of a water buffalo fill the warm air in a small Vietnamese village. Life here is full of simple joys, muddy fields, and the quiet bond between a boy and his buffalo friends. Their story carries the heartbeats of family, nature, and growing up far from the noisy city.

Quick Assessment
This gentle middle-grade fiction explores a boy’s close relationship with two water buffalo in rural Vietnam’s central highlands. Through vivid sensory descriptions and cultural insights, it offers readers ages 9-12 a window into family life, nature, and childhood in a different part of the world. The story contains no intense content, making it suitable for this age group.
